What is Supreme Petrochem P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ate. As of today, Supreme Petrochem's PE Ratio without NRI is 39.85. Supreme Petrochem's 5-Year EBITDA growth rate is -7.30%. Therefore, Supreme Petrochem's PEG Ratio for today is N/A.

* The 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ate is the 5-year average EBITDA per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Supreme Petrochem  (NSE:SPLPETRO)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Supreme Petrochem Business Description

Supreme Petrochem Ltd manufactures and trades in petrochemicals. The company owns production facilities at Raigad, Maharashtra, and in Chennai, Tamil Nadu. Its product portfolio consists of general-purpose polystyrene, specialty polystyrene, masterbatches, high-impact polystyrene, FR high-impact polystyrene, toughened polystyrene, and extruded polystyrene foam boards, among others. Supreme Petrochem has only one primary reporting segment, styrenics. Geographically, the majority of its revenue is generated from India, followed by other markets outside India.
